Stone masonry rep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the structural integrity and aesthetic appeal of stone structures. These services typically involve assessing the condition of existing stonework, identifying areas of deterioration, and performing necessary repairs to prevent further damage. Repair techniques may include replacing damaged stones, repointing mortar joints, cleaning surfaces to remove dirt and biological growth, and consolidating weakened stone materials.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and methods to ensure that repairs blend seamlessly with the original masonry, preserving the property's historical or architectural value.

This service helps address common problems such as cracking, spalling, erosion, and mortar deterioration that can compromise the stability of stone walls, facades, chimneys, and other masonry features.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ause stones to weaken or shift, leading to gaps or instability. Repairing these issues not only enhances the safety of the structure but also prevents more extensive damage that could result in costly replacements or structural failures. Proper stone masonry repair can extend the lifespan of a property’s exterior features and maintain its visual appeal.

Properties that frequently utilize stone masonry repair services include historic buildings, residential homes with stone facades, commercial properties with stone exteriors, and public structures such as bridges or monuments. These structures often require specialized attention to preserve their original appearance and ensure long-term durability. Stone masonry repair is also common in landscape features such as retaining walls and outdoor fireplaces, where structural integrity is vital for safety and functionality. The overview below groups typical Stone Masonry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Overland Park, KS.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or Costs - Typically range from $50 to $100 per hour for stone masonry repair services. The total cost depends on the project's size and complexity, with smaller repairs costing around $200 and larger restorations exceeding $2,000.

Material Expenses - The price of stone materials varies, often between $10 and $50 per square foot. Custom or specialty stones can increase costs, impacting the overall project budget.

Project Size - Small repairs, such as patching or crack filling, may cost under $500. Larger projects, like rebuilding or extensive restoration, can range from $1,500 to over $10,000 depending on scope.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include surface preparation, cleaning, or structural reinforcement, which can add several hundred dollars to the total. These charges depend on the specific needs of each repair project.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of stone masonry repair services are available? Local pros typically offer repairs for cracked or damaged stones, repointing mortar joints, restoring historic stonework, and cleaning or sealing stone surfaces.

How can I tell if my stonework need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, loose stones, crumbling mortar, or water stains that suggest deterioration and the need for professional assessment.

What materials are used in stone masonry repair? Repair materials often include matching mortar, stone replacements, sealants, and cleaning agents that are suitable for the specific type of stone.

Is stone masonry repair suitable for historic buildings? Yes, experienced local contractors can perform restorations that preserve the historic integrity while addressing structural issues.
